Blaster qualifications. - 1926.901

1926.901(a)

A blaster shall be able to understand and give written and oral orders.

1926.901(b)

A blaster shall be in good physical condition and not be addicted to narcotics, intoxicants, or similar types of drugs.

1926.901(c)

A blaster shall be qualified, by reason of training, knowledge, or experience, in the field of transporting, storing, handling, and use of explosives, and have a working knowledge of State and local laws and regulations which pertain to explosives.

1926.901(d)

Blasters shall be required to furnish satisfactory evidence of competency in handling explosives and performing in a safe manner the type of blasting that will be required.

1926.901(e)

The blaster shall be knowledgeable and competent in the use of each type of blasting method used.
